I'm not exactly sure what you mean by unresponsive but if the editor is slow and laggy you might want to try these things:
-turn off things you don't need in the mod manager (for example dynamic objects, vehicles, soldiers etc)
-turn off gameplay layers and use default (layer 0)
- if you have for example insurgency layer active make sure you have vehicles and stuff related to GPO activated in mod manager.

-with editor running, open photoshop and open a file (a picture for example) then close photoshop. The editor should become much smoother and react better to things you change.

(-Run the editor in win xp sp2 compatability mode and administrator)

I'm guessing your problem is a bit different from just a laggy and slow editor but these things might be good to know about anyway and who knows, might solve the problem..
